Ok I'm thinking the heads on old man's truck have the truck making low compression ratio, reason?

It's a stock 350 bore, dished pistons, I think they are cast, the heads(forget numbers) are gm replacments with 2.02 and are 76cc I think or 72cc. I also think by tuning the carb with a vac. gauage it has worn valve guides.

ANyway to tell this forsure like some tell tale signs?

ANYWAYS LOL I hear nothing but good things on vortec's, and it's be carb'd and I know I gotta get a new intake for carb, but would anything else need changed? will the headers and hei and everything else work?

Now onto the heads, is there a particular set(casting number) that's best or better then another? Would they all be a good upgrade? What vehicles should I lok for some in? and if it's 305 they'd be the same and work right and not be funky like some of the older gm castings for 305's with like 5xish cc and tiny valves like 1.8x or 1.7x?

Oh I know I need other valve covers too or adapters.

Basically I just see alot of info and want schooled on what would be the best stock vortec's to use, since they'd be cheaper then buying new ones. I would do a valve job and new valve seals as well of course. I don't want to do any port/polish work just clean up and valve grind compound stuff like that.

I figure they'd bump up the CR right, and it'd be good as long as I can do pump gas still.

Now lastly if not vortec's what else would be a good stock gm upgrade since these have lower CR and big valves, would a stock set of 1.94's be better off or should I mainly focus on some lower cc numbers like 64's or so?

The motor has a comp cam 268h cam which has 218 dration at .050 and .454 lift on both sides. duration is on both sides as well.

You can use the stock rockers (the ones that came off the vortec motor) no problem on that 268h and then pushrod length on mine seemed to be stock when I measured with the adjustable one from comp cams. Same SBC pushrod.
